Argocd

Was ist der beste Weg, Argocd als Code zu installieren?

Was ist der beste Weg, Argocd als Code zu installieren?
  1. Wie implementieren Sie Argocd?
  2. Dies ist die am besten empfohlene Methode zur Bereitstellung von Kubernetes Manifests mit ArgoCD?
  3. Warum ist Argocd besser als Jenkins??
  4. Woher weiß ich, ob Argocd installiert ist?
  5. Ist Argocd Pull oder Push?
  6. Kann ich Kubernetes lokal installieren??
  7. Was ist der Unterschied zwischen Helm und Argocd?
  8. Verwendet Argocd Helm??
  9. Was ist Helm Installationsbefehl?
  10. Wie funktioniert Argocd??
  11. Welche Art von Anwendungen können Argocd bereitstellen?
  12. Ist argocd a gitops?
  13. Warum ist Argocd beliebt??
  14. Was ist der Unterschied zwischen Gitops und Argocd?

Wie implementieren Sie Argocd?

Erstellen Sie zunächst einen Namespace, um den ArgoCD zu installieren und den Befehl Kubectl auszuführen. Erstellen Sie den Namespace ArgoCD . Schließlich wenden Sie das Skript an, das kubectl anwenden -n argocd -f https: // raw anwenden.GithubuSercontent.com/argoproj/argo-cd/stabil/manifests/installieren.Yaml, um die Installation zu beenden.

Dies ist die am besten empfohlene Methode zur Bereitstellung von Kubernetes Manifests mit ArgoCD?

Die Verwendung eines separaten GIT -Repositorys, um Ihre Kubernetes -Manifeste zu halten, die die Konfiguration von Ihrem Anwendungsquellcode getrennt zu halten, wird aus den folgenden Gründen dringend empfohlen: Es bietet eine saubere Trennung von Anwendungscode vs. Anwendungskonfiguration.

Warum ist Argocd besser als Jenkins??

Argo CD unterstützt Multi-Messen. Auf der anderen Seite unterstützen Flux-CD und Jenkins X standardmäßig keine Multi-Mieter-Anwendungen. Die folgende Tabelle zeichnet einen tieferen Vergleich zwischen den Werkzeugen. Während alle drei oben diskutierten Tools ihre eigenen Fähigkeiten haben, ist jeder von ihnen auch mit einer Reihe von Nachteilen verbunden.

Woher weiß ich, ob Argocd installiert ist?

Sobald die Installation erfolgreich abgeschlossen ist.

Ist Argocd Pull oder Push?

ARGO CD ermöglicht Unternehmen, native Anwendungen und Workflows mit Cloud -Anwendungen und Workflows mit Gitops deklarativ aufzubauen und auszuführen. Es handelt.

Kann ich Kubernetes lokal installieren??

Sie können Kubernetes herunterladen, um einen Kubernetes -Cluster auf einer lokalen Maschine, in der Cloud oder für Ihr eigenes Datencenter bereitzustellen.

Was ist der Unterschied zwischen Helm und Argocd?

ARGO -CD ist ein CD -Tool/eine Plattform, mit der Anwendungen für mehrere Umgebungen bereitgestellt werden können. Helm ist ein Paketmanager, mit dem Anwendungen in einer einzigen Umgebung bereitgestellt werden können. Daher ist die Argo -CD besser für komplexere Bereitstellungen geeignet, und Helm eignet sich besser für einfache Bereitstellungen.

Verwendet Argocd Helm??

Die Argo -CD hat eine native Unterstützung für das Helm integriert in. Sie können direkt ein Helm -Diagramm -Repo aufrufen und die Werte direkt im Anwendungsmanifest angeben. Außerdem können Sie Helm auf Ihrem Cluster direkt mit der ARGO -CD -Benutzeroberfläche oder der Argocd CLI interagieren und verwalten.

Was ist Helm Installationsbefehl?

Zusammenfassung. Dieser Befehl installiert ein Diagrammarchiv. Das Installationsargument muss eine Diagrammreferenz sein, ein Pfad zu einem verpackten Diagramm, ein Pfad zu einem ausgepackten Diagrammverzeichnis oder einer URL.

Wie funktioniert Argocd??

Die Argo -CD vergleicht die gewünschte Konfiguration im Git -Repo mit dem tatsächlichen Zustand im Kubernetes -Cluster und synchronisiert das, was im Git -Repo zum Cluster definiert ist, und überschreiben Sie, ob das Update manuell durchgeführt wurde.

Welche Art von Anwendungen können Argocd bereitstellen?

Es kann verschiedene Arten von Kubernetes -Manifests verarbeiten, darunter JSONNET, Kustomize -Anwendungen, Helmdiagramme und YAML/JSON -Dateien, und unterstützt Webhook -Benachrichtigungen von Gitlab und Bitbucket.

Ist argocd a gitops?

Was ist argocd? Die Argo -CD ist ein deklaratives kontinuierliches Lieferwerkzeug für Kubernetes -Anwendungen. Es verwendet den Gitops -Stil, um Kubernetes -Cluster zu erstellen und zu verwalten.

Warum ist Argocd beliebt??

ArgoCD ist ein benutzerfreundliches Tool, mit dem Entwicklungsteams Anwendungen bereitstellen und verwalten können, ohne viel über Kubernetes lernen zu müssen, und ohne vollen Zugriff auf das Kubernetes -System zu erhalten.

Was ist der Unterschied zwischen Gitops und Argocd?

Das Git -Repository enthält eine vollständige Aufzeichnung aller Änderungen, einschließlich aller Details der Umgebung in jeder Phase des Prozesses. Die Argo -CD behandelt die letzteren Phasen des Gitops -Prozesses und stellt sicher, dass neue Konfigurationen korrekt in einem Kubernetes -Cluster bereitgestellt werden.

Änderungen spiegeln sich im Azure -App -Dienst nach der Bereitstellung über Azure DevOps Pipeline nicht wider
Wie verbinde ich Azure DevOps mit dem Azure App -Service??Wie mache ich Azure DevOps Pipeline beheben?Wie kann ich Azure App -Dienst beheben??Wie ber...
So laden Sie Bilder auf RDS MySQL hoch, ohne den S3 -Bucket zu verwenden
Kann ich Bilder in RDS speichern??Kann RDS aus S3 lesen?Können wir das Bild in der MySQL -Datenbank speichern??Welches DB ist am besten, um Bilder zu...
So richten Sie MySQL DB für Feature -Tests ein?
Wie wird MySQL zum Testen verwendet?? Wie wird MySQL zum Testen verwendet??Der MySQLTEST -Test -Engine prüft die Ergebniscodes aus der Ausführung je...